Best sellers

There are 2073 products.

Showing 1213-1224 of 2073 item(s)

Active filters

LIMAR 360
Quick view

LIMAR 360

Price €48.00
  • Out-of-Stock
DMT MH1
Quick view

DMT MH1

Price €259.00
Showing 1213-1224 of 2073 item(s)